Northern Illinois University Scholarship Details
The Northern Illinois University Scholarship is offered annually to both domestic and international students seeking admission into graduate degree programs at NIU.
Funding opportunities are available through:
- Teaching Assistantships
- Research Assistantships
- Graduate Fellowships
- Merit Scholarships
- Tuition Waivers
- Research Grants
Northern Illinois University provides graduate programs across a wide range of disciplines, including:
- Engineering
- Natural Sciences
- Health Sciences
- Social Sciences
- Business and Management
- Humanities
- Education
- Technology and Applied Sciences
Graduate assistants work closely with faculty members, researchers, and administrative professionals while gaining valuable academic, teaching, and professional experience. These positions not only provide financial support but also enhance students’ career prospects after graduation.
Eligibility Requirements for Northern Illinois University Scholarship 2026
To be considered for the Northern Illinois University Scholarship, applicants must:
- Hold a bachelor’s degree for Master’s admission or a master’s degree for PhD admission.
- Meet the admission requirements of their chosen graduate program.
- Satisfy the English language proficiency requirements of Northern Illinois University.
- Apply for available graduate opportunities or contact potential supervisors where required.
- Demonstrate strong academic performance and research potential.

Required Documents for Northern Illinois University Scholarship 2026
Applicants should prepare the following documents:
- Completed Application Form
- Updated Curriculum Vitae (CV)
- Academic Transcripts
- Recommendation Letters
- Statement of Purpose (if required)
- English Language Proficiency Certificate (for non-native English speakers)
- Standardized Test Scores (if required by the program)
How to Apply for Northern Illinois University Scholarship 2026
Follow these steps to apply:
Step 1: Explore Available Graduate Opportunities
Visit the Northern Illinois University graduate admissions webpage and identify a suitable Master’s or PhD program.
Step 2: Contact Potential Supervisors
For research-based programs, reach out to faculty members whose research interests align with your academic goals.
Step 3: Submit Graduate Admission Application
Complete and submit your graduate application through the NIU Graduate School portal.
Step 4: Upload Required Documents
Provide all supporting documents, including transcripts, CV, recommendation letters, and test scores where applicable.
Step 5: Apply for Funding Opportunities
Qualified students may automatically be considered for assistantships, scholarships, fellowships, grants, or tuition waivers depending on the department and program.
Step 6: Submit Before the Deadline
International applicants are encouraged to submit their applications before October 1, 2026.
